The Fisherman at Sunrise

Written at sunrise on Edisto Beach.


July 2023


Though not seen, I hear you.

Your sled dragging the sand.

Awakened at first light,

You come to cast your line.


Your worn gear is not new,

Your hunt is strictly planned.

Awaiting the first bite,

You sit back and recline.


Though you cast it anew,

Stiff-backed your old pole stands.

A wish, a prayer, a plight.

You seek favor from thine.


Though he does not have to,

Your god placed in remand,

A wig’ling fish to fight,

You pull, bending the spline.


Now Reel!

Reel with great haste,

You must win at this race.


He has taken your bait,

Now you must seal his fate.


What you came here to do,

He is giving to you.


So Reel!

Reel, my friend,

As we all comprehend,


That this moment in time

Needs not story or rhyme.


It’s a battle of old,

And you mustn’t now fold.


Keep Reeling! Reeling with gusto.

He is yours, this he must know.


The rod is bending,

This fight seems unending.


The spool gives a shriek,

This fish is not meek.


Reel! “Reel!” I yell.

Though on silent lips fell.


You dig in your heels,

Now grunting with peals.


As you go toe to toe,

And you put on a show.


Real! This is all that is real.

In war finely you feel.


You have waited so long,

Now finish your song.


The final act is here,

The curtain draws near.


So Reel! Prove your worth!

Dismantle his mirth!


You scream, “He is mine!”

With the jerk of your spine.


You think all is well,

As he comes up the swell.


Reeling! Now you are reeling.

Back and forth, nearly keeling.


But you will not give in,

You can still see his fin.


“He belongs in a tin,

Fish must bow to men.


As I cut him up thin,

I will tell all my kin,


Of the battle herein,

And where I have been.”


Reeling! Reeling inside,

To your god you deride.


If you lose it’s a sin,

An eternal chagrin.


Now your patience wears thin,

He is under your skin.


As you pray once again,

“Let me pull him in!”


Reeling! Now reeling with sweat,

You feel sudden threat.


The fish leaps with a grin,

He will not let you win.


Now the reel will not spin,

As you battle within,


And then…


Snap! He is gone with the break of the line.

Now what will you say unto thine?
